FUEL PUMP
DRIVE
CONTROL
SYSTEM
INSPECTION
N14PKAA
(1) Disconnect
the high tension
cable from
the ignition
coil.
(2) Holding
the fuel hose connected
to the injection
mixer with
a hard, crank the engine
and check that pulsation
of fuel
flow
is felt to the hand.
NOTE
If no fuel flow pulsation
is felt, check the ignition
switch,
control
relay and fuel pump.
BOOST METER CONTROL
SYSTEM
INSPECTION
N14PNAA
(1) Disconnect
the
vacuum
hose
(white
stripe)
from
the
injection
mixer and connect
a vacuum
gauge,to
the nipple
(vacuum
nipple
"M").
(2) Make
road test and check that the boost meter
indication
nearly
agrees
with
the vacuum
gauge
indication.
(3) If the
indication
deviates
greatly,
check
the harness
for
open
or short circuit and also check the boost
meter,
air
flow
sensor
and engine
speed
sensor.

ECI SYSTEM
INSPECTION
BY USING
ECI CHECKER
N14PDBC
The electric system
of ECI system
can be quickly inspected
and
maintained
if the electric
input and output
sign.als of ECU are
checked
by ECI checker
and the component
whose
abnormal-
ity is indicated
by the
signal
and the
harness
connected
between
ECU and the component
is checked
as well.
Using
the
special
tools
(EC1 harness
connector
A and
ECI
checker),
perform
the ECI system
checks
by the following
procedure.
Caution
Perform
these
checks
after
completion
of all steps
in the
preceding
"CHECK
PROCEDURE
(SELF-DIAGNOSIS)".
